Transaction 70b85aeb155067e5cea185834f4314dd452f2f762fe5ee57dabe17e26c09634f
1 Input
1 Output
-
70b85aeb155067e5cea185834f4314dd452f2f762fe5ee57dabe17e26c09634f:0
- value
- 3808183
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e57c6766bc450a7ffff8f42e1a4ccf70aa2ff2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 176iWdDHNeKyptRswo475WoSSH1TwDrC1R